Norwegian Church Aid (NCA) is a non-profit organization working in 23 countries worldwide to eradicate poverty. In Ethiopia, we have been operating since 1974, engaged in short term emergency response and long-term development programs.
Our intervention in Ethiopia focuses on Climate Resilient Water, Sanitation, and Hygiene; Gender-Based Violence; Peacebuilding; Faith-Based Climate Action; Humanitarian Emergency Response. In 2021, NCA/E has also launched a new initiative called Renewable Energy, Greening, and Sustainability Program.
We are currently operating in seven regions: Amhara, Gambella, Oromia, Somali, Southern Nations Nationalities and People’s State, Sidama, Tigray, and at the Federal level. To achieve our development goals, we work with faith-based and non-faith-based actors that have demonstrated strong grassroots reach and influence in society.
NCA is a member of the ACT Alliance, a coalition of organizations working together in over 140 countries to create positive and sustainable change in people’s lives.

Job Summary:
The Emergency Finance & Logistic Senior Officer is a new position to ensure NCA policies, procedures, and guidelines in relation to finance, HR, procurement, and transport activities are in place while implementing the emergency response in Afder Zone of Somali Regional State. He/she will assist the Project Coordinator in managing the financial and budget-related activities, oversee HR policies are met and keep proper staff-related data and documentation, handle the procurement and logistic activities of the field office, ensure proper materials management, and oversee the administrative tasks in Afder Zone and respective implementation Weredas.
The position requires a highly trusted and loyal individual with strong personal integrity and commitment to keeping all the resources responsibly. Prior experience in INGOs platform and in emergency sites is a plus. The person to be employed need to accept the Code of Conduct of ACT Alliance.
